The City of Edgewater is soliciting sealed bids from qualified and licensed contractors to provide all labor, materials, equipment, supervision, and incidentals necessary for construction of the SUNTrail North Segment from S.R. 442 to Dale Street, FPID 439862-3-54-01.
This project is being constructed in coordination with the Florida Department of Transportation (FDOT) and shall comply with the FDOT Standard Specifications for Road and Bridge Construction, FY 2025-26 Edition , applicable FDOT Standard Plans, applicable Florida Greenbook requirements, permit conditions, Volusia County right-of-way requirements where applicable, City requirements, and the Contract Documents.
Bidders are required to carefully review all plans, specifications, special provisions, permits, utility coordination requirements, and site conditions prior to submitting a bid. Submission of a bid shall be considered evidence that the Bidder has examined all Contract Documents and understands the scope and conditions of the Work.
This project is funded through the Florida Department of Transportation’s State-funded Shared Use Nonmotorized SUN Trail Network Program for construction of the SUNTrail North Segment from S.R. 442 to Dale Street in the City of Edgewater. The successful Bidder will hereinafter be referred to as the “Contractor.” The project is more fully described in the attached plans, specifications, permits, utility coordination documents, and other Contract Documents.
The improvements under this Contract generally consist of construction of a concrete shared-use path, driveway improvements, drainage modifications, lighting, pedestrian signalization, signing and pavement marking improvements, utility coordination, restoration, and related work shown in the Contract Documents.
Detailed requirements are outlined in the attached drawings, specifications, permits, utility coordination documents, and all other Contract Documents.
The SUNTrail Project is part of a statewide initiative led by the Florida Department of Transportation to expand and connect a network of multi-use trails throughout Florida. This project represents a key segment within the City of Edgewater’s transportation and recreational infrastructure system.
The project has been developed under FDOT coordination and includes engineered plans and specifications prepared by Stanley Consultants, Inc., under the responsible charge of licensed Professional Engineers.

The Contractor will be required to coordinate closely with FDOT, City staff, Volusia County where applicable, utility providers, separate utility relocation work, and adjacent property owners/residents, as the project includes multiple infrastructure components and may involve concurrent utility operations, right-of-way constraints, access impacts, and utility adjustments.
The City of Edgewater serves an area of 25.24 square miles with a population of approximately 24,981. The City’s population density is estimated at 989.7 people per square mile.
